Resumen
Commercial adhesives commonly used in plywood panels’ production contain resins having formaldehyde in its composition, which is a carcinogen. The castor-oil based polyurethane adhesive is an alternative to replace those adhesives, because its origin is a natural raw material, does not release harmful substances to health or the environment, due to its solvent free composition, and can be commercially produced. Plywood panels were produced with castor-oil based polyurethane adhesive using 180 g/m², 160 g/m², 140 g/m² and 120 g/m², with urea-formaldehyde and phenolformaldehyde based adhesive using 180 g/m². Specimens were cut and the bending and shear glue line tests were done. The results showed no strength reduction of the boards produced with the polyurethane adhesive for both tests in normal conditions of humidity and temperature. Critical conditions of humidity and temperature can cause a strength reduction on those boards. It means that castor-oil based polyurethane adhesive can replace commercial adhesives for internal use plywood panels.
